 I have used one of this months new release Tweens, Camping Tween who I have coloured with promarkers and for the puffy part of my card I have used Woodware Fluffy Stuff on the marshmallow, if you haven't used this product it is fab, it comes is a bottle like stickles and you squeeze it onto your design and then heat it with a heat gun and it puffs up. I've tried to take a photo below to show you how it is raised off the card.
